Chris Lattner1d1adea2003-08-01 04:39:05 +00001//===- TableGen.cpp - Top-Level TableGen implementation -------------------===//
2//
3// TableGen is a tool which can be used to build up a description of something,
4// then invoke one or more "tablegen backends" to emit information about the
5// description in some predefined format. In practice, this is used by the LLVM
6// code generators to automate generation of a code generator through a
7// high-level description of the target.
8//
9//===----------------------------------------------------------------------===//

195// ParseMachineCode - Try to split the vector of instructions (which is
196// intentially taken by-copy) in half, narrowing down the possible instructions
197// that we may have found. Eventually, this list will get pared down to zero or
198// one instruction, in which case we have a match or failure.
199//
200static Record *ParseMachineCode(std::vector<Record*>::iterator InstsB,
201 std::vector<Record*>::iterator InstsE,
202 unsigned char *M) {
203 assert(InstsB != InstsE && "Empty range?");
204 if (InstsB+1 == InstsE) {
205 // Only a single instruction, see if we match it...
206 Record *Inst = *InstsB;
207 for (unsigned i = 0, e = getNumBits(Inst); i != e; ++i)
208 if (BitInit *BI = dynamic_cast<BitInit*>(getBit(Inst, i)))
209 if (getMemoryBit(M, i) != BI->getValue())
Chris Lattner1d1adea2003-08-01 04:39:05 +0000210 throw std::string("Parse failed!\n");
Chris Lattnere62c1182002-12-02 01:23:04 +0000211 return Inst;
212 }
213
214 unsigned MaxBits = ~0;
215 for (std::vector<Record*>::iterator I = InstsB; I != InstsE; ++I)
216 MaxBits = std::min(MaxBits, getNumBits(*I));
217
218 unsigned FirstFixedBit = getFirstFixedBitInSequence(InstsB, InstsE, 0);
219 unsigned FirstVaryingBit, LastFixedBit;
220 do {
221 FirstVaryingBit = ~0;
222 LastFixedBit = ~0;
223 for (std::vector<Record*>::iterator I = InstsB+1; I != InstsE; ++I)
224 FindInstDifferences(*InstsB, *I, FirstFixedBit, MaxBits,
225 FirstVaryingBit, LastFixedBit);
226 if (FirstVaryingBit == MaxBits) {
227 std::cerr << "ERROR: Could not find bit to distinguish between "
228 << "the following entries!\n";
229 PrintRange(InstsB, InstsE);
230 }
231
232#if 0
233 std::cerr << "FVB: " << FirstVaryingBit << " - " << LastFixedBit
234 << ": " << InstsE-InstsB << "\n";
235#endif
236
237 FirstFixedBit = getFirstFixedBitInSequence(InstsB, InstsE, FirstVaryingBit);
238 } while (FirstVaryingBit != FirstFixedBit);
239
240 //std::cerr << "\n\nX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XX\n\n";
241 //PrintRange(InstsB, InstsE);
242
243 // Sort the Insts list so that the entries have all of the bits in the range
244 // [FirstVaryingBit,LastFixedBit) sorted. These bits are all guaranteed to be
245 // set to either 0 or 1 (BitInit values), which simplifies things.
246 //
247 std::sort(InstsB, InstsE, BitComparator(FirstVaryingBit, LastFixedBit));
248
249 // Once the list is sorted by these bits, split the bit list into smaller
250 // lists, and recurse on each one.
251 //
252 std::vector<Record*>::iterator RangeBegin = InstsB;
253 Record *Match = 0;
254 while (RangeBegin != InstsE) {
255 std::vector<Record*>::iterator RangeEnd = RangeBegin+1;
256 while (RangeEnd != InstsE &&
257 BitRangesEqual(*RangeBegin, *RangeEnd, FirstVaryingBit, LastFixedBit))
258 ++RangeEnd;
259
260 // We just identified a range of equal instructions. If this range is the
261 // input range, we were not able to distinguish between the instructions in
262 // the set. Print an error and exit!
263 //
264 if (RangeBegin == InstsB && RangeEnd == InstsE) {
265 std::cerr << "Error: Could not distinguish among the following insts!:\n";
266 PrintRange(InstsB, InstsE);
267 abort();
268 }
269
Chris Lattner7b1d49b2002-12-03 20:01:04 +0000270#if 0
271 std::cerr << "FVB: " << FirstVaryingBit << " - " << LastFixedBit
272 << ": [" << RangeEnd-RangeBegin << "] - ";
273 for (int i = LastFixedBit-1; i >= (int)FirstVaryingBit; --i)
274 std::cerr << (int)((BitInit*)getBit(*RangeBegin, i))->getValue() << " ";
275 std::cerr << "\n";
276#endif
277
Chris Lattnere62c1182002-12-02 01:23:04 +0000278 if (Record *R = ParseMachineCode(RangeBegin, RangeEnd, M)) {
279 if (Match) {
280 std::cerr << "Error: Multiple matches found:\n";
281 PrintRange(InstsB, InstsE);
282 }
283
284 assert(Match == 0 && "Multiple matches??");
285 Match = R;
286 }
287 RangeBegin = RangeEnd;
288 }
289
290 return Match;
291}
